JKPICCA Holds Elections, Welcomes New Leadership.
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terWhatsappTelegram

Srinagar: Mr. Bashir Ahmad Naik has been elected as the new President of the Jammu & Kashmir Fruits, Vegetables Processing & Integrated Cold Chain Association (JKPICCA), representing Controlled Atmosphere (CA) Storage Units across Jammu & Kashmir. The association successfully held elections on November 9, 2024, to fill the positions of President, Vice President & General Secretary cum Treasurer. The event took place at the Directorate of Horticulture in Raj Bagh Srinagar, with a robust turnout of around 85% of the association’s members who collectively represent nearly 500,000 MT of CA storage capacity across 86 units.

JKPICCA plays a vital role in connecting various stakeholders within the cold storage and fruit processing sectors, working to address shared challenges and promote industry interests.

The election process was overseen by a distinguished panel of observers, ensuring transparency and integrity throughout. Mr. Bashir Ahmad Naik expressed his gratitude to all members, pledging to advocate for the industry’s needs at key forums and to focus on its growth and development. The newly elected Vice President, Mr. Arif Mir emphasized that the leadership team is committed to collaborating with all stakeholders to drive progress in the sector.

Mr. Ishfaq Ahmad Malik, elected as General Secretary cum Treasurer, assured JKPICCA members of his dedication to advancing the sector’s interests and addressing key issues for the industry’s benefit.

Outgoing President Mr. Majid Aslam Wafai congratulated the newly elected office bearers, expressing confidence in their capacity to lead JKPICCA to new heights.

The election proceedings were attended by various officials and observers, including Faiz Bakshi, Secretary General of KCCI; Syed Shabbir, General Manager of DIC Pulwama; Mukhtar Ahmad, President of the Industrial Association Lassipora; Ajaz Ahmad, General Manager of DIC Shopian; Mehraj Qureshi from FCIK; and Shafiq Ahmad Mir, CEC of IAL. Representatives from multiple mandi associations, including Pulwama, Shopian, and Pacchar, also observed the election process. The Election Commission, composed of Irshad Ahmad, Ashaq Hussain Shangloo, Mushtaq Ahmad Dar, and Manzoor Ahmad Sheikh, played a key role in ensuring a smooth and fair election.
